Morgan Stanley Investment Management: Shift in direction may benefit assets outside the United States

Morgan Stanley Investment Management's Jitania Kandhari stated that the Fed rate cut and the weakening US dollar have opened the door for emerging market stocks to outperform US stocks. "Factors such as the positive economic growth and interest rates for the US have peaked, which is now starting to benefit markets outside the US," said Kandhari, who serves as the Deputy Chief Investment Officer for Emerging Markets and Head of Macroeconomic Research, adding that the "overall macro fundamentals of emerging markets look good."
